My Agro Hypermart offers agro-based products at much cheaper prices
PUTRAJAYA, Jan 4 (Bernama) -- My Agro Hypermart, a one-stop centre (OSC) for the country's agro-based products, will begin operations on Friday with prices as much as 30% cheaper compared to similar products on the open market.
The outlet, which offers 2,045 products from 250 local entrepreneurs including ready-made food, beverages, frozen food, canned food, cakes and biscuits, food ingredients as well as health and beauty products, is located at the Malaysian Agro Exposition Park (MAEPS), Serdang and will be open from 10am to 10pm.
A branch of the 'Kedai Ikan Rakyat 1Malaysia' (KIR1M), which was recently launched in Setiawangsa, Kuala Lumpur and offering wet products including chicken and vegetables up to 40 per cent cheaper than the open market, will also be located at the centre to be launched by Agriculture and Agro-based Industry Minister Datuk Seri Noh Omar on Sunday.
The Secretary-General of the Agriculture and Agro-based Industry Ministry, Datuk Mohd Hashim Abdullah said the centre was an initiative by the ministry to implement the eighth entry point project (EPP) under the agricultural National Key Economic Area (NKEA), namely the establishment of an Integrated Food Park.
He said the project was achieved through the cooperation of the private sector, namely Rukun Saksama Sdn Bhd which forked out an investment of RM10.5 million, and the products there were obtained at a much cheaper price directly from the producers of the products without involving any middleman.
